Nine African countries join Afreximbank’s PAPSS platform in push for ‘de-dollarization’

A pan-African payment system that would allow African nations to trade among themselves, using their own currencies, is gaining momentum, as the platform has recently started commercial operations with nine countries having signed up so far, according to the Afreximbank President Benedict Oramah. Afreximbank poised to help Senegal raise $500m

The African Export-Import Bank (Afreximbank) is in advanced discussion with Senegal’s oil refiner to raise $500 million in syndicated finance, a senior official of the bank told Reuters. ECA, Afreximbank launch digital platform to boost intra-Africa trade

The Economic Commission for Africa (ECA) and Afreximbank have announced the development of the African Trade Exchange Platform (ATEX), a digital business-to-business (B2B) and business-to-government (B2G) tool to help boost intra-African trade under the African Continental Free Trade Area (AfCFTA). Afreximbank approves $200 million for Uganda crude pipeline as NGOs denounce the project

Afreximbank has approved $200 million toward financing of a contested oil pipeline to export Uganda’s crude, while a report released by two environmental NGOs has warned of potentially “unacceptable” damage caused by a controversial project involving French oil giant TotalEnergies and China’s National Offshore Oil Corporation (CNOOC). Morocco’s OCP secures a $350 million loan facility from Afreximbank

Morocco’s phosphate group, OCP, has secured a $350 million loan facility from the African Export-Import Bank (Afreximbank) that will support the Group’s expansion plans across Africa.
